#Pandora Papers

2 Articles

Week Rewind 53: Last Week in a Quick Snap

Week Rewind 53, you will get all the quick rewinds of last week, including hot topics and new innovations. Last week from  4th October 2021 to  10th  October 2021, was a wonderful week

World’s biggest leak ever Pandora Papers documents reveal secret financial dealings of world leaders and billionaires

The International Consortium of Investigative Journalists (ICIJ) received the documents, which had been then exceeded on to media retailers together with the BBC’s Panorama program and The Guard